James V. 'Jim' Elliott

James V. “Jim” Elliott, 83, formerly of Butler, passed away into the arms of his lord and savior Nov. 11 in Wytheville, Va.

Jim was born June 25, 1927, in Elk Creek, Va.

He was a veteran of the U.S. Army in World War II, where he served in Germany. He was a 63-year member of the IBEW in Winston-Salem, N.C.

Jim was a devoted father who cherished time spent with his children, grandchildren and great-grandchildren. He was an avid Steelers fan and loved hunting and fishing.

Jim is survived by his wife of more than 65 years, Lou E. Elliott of Wytheville; his children, Shirley (Joe) Cavender and Roger M. Elliott, both of Wytheville, and Ed and Donna Elliott of Butler; a sister, Mrs. Johnnie (Shelby) Delp of Elk Creek, Va.; five grandchildren; nine great-grandchildren; and several nieces and nephews.

A son, James A. Elliott, preceded him in death, May 8, 2009.

Jim and Lou are members of Holy Trinity Lutheran Church in Wytheville.

<B>ELLIOTT</B> — Burial for James V. “Jim” Elliott, who died Thursday, Nov. 11, was held at the Osborne Family Cemetery in Independence, Va., with members of the VFW Post 7726 conducting military rites. Arrangements were made by the <B>GRUBBS FUNERAL HOME</B> in Wytheville.A memorial donation may be made in Jim’s memory to the Agape Food Pantry c/o Holy Trinity Lutheran Church, Wytheville, VA 24382.
